PER CURIAM:
Kristopher Owen Daniels petitions for a writ of mandamus, alleging that the district
court has unduly delayed acting on his 28 U.S.C. § 2255 motion. He seeks an order from
this court directing the district court to act. Our review of the district court’s docket reveals
that the district court denied Daniels’ § 2255 motion on November 8, 2019. Accordingly,
because the district court has decided Daniels’ case, we deny the mandamus petition as
moot. We dispense with oral argument because the facts and legal contentions are
adequately presented in the materials before this court and argument would not aid the
decisional process.
PETITION DENIED
